What is the average salary in Sewickley, PA?

The average salary in Sewickley, PA is $47,472 per year.

Job seekers in Sewickley, PA, can expect a competitive salary landscape. The average yearly salary stands at $47,472. This figure reflects the diverse range of industries and job roles available in the area. Salaries vary based on the industry and the specific job role.


The salary distribution shows a range of earnings. The lowest 10% of earners make around $24,500 annually. The highest 10% earn over $121,000. Most people fall in the middle, with salaries between $33,300 and $86,000. This spread offers opportunities for various skill levels and career stages. How does the cost of living in Sewickley, PA compare to the national average?

Sewickley, PA, has a cost of living index that is slightly below the nationwide average. The overall cost of living index for Sewickley is 98, which is 2% lower than the national average of 100. This means that, on average, residents in Sewickley can expect to spend slightly less on most goods and services compared to the average American. Specifically, housing costs in Sewickley are 5% lower than the national average, while groceries and utilities are nearly on par. Transportation and miscellaneous costs also mirror the national average closely, with healthcare being the only category slightly above average at 2%.
